What is Learner Tien?
Learner Tien is a digital learning initiative that seeks to provide personalised educational experiences using adaptive learning technologies. Its innovative approach ensures that every student, regardless of their starting point, can engage with content at their own pace. This is particularly significant in a world where traditional learning methods often fail to address individual needs.

Recent Developments
In 2023, Learner Tien announced its expansion into underserved communities, partnering with local organisations to deliver workshops and training sessions aimed at empowering educators with the tools necessary to implement personalised learning strategies. This initiative has already reported an increase in student engagement by 25% in pilot areas, indicating the program’s potential to transform lives.
